The cruel statistic is that every 30 seconds, a Romanian woman becomes a victim of domestic abuse. Very few of them actually talk about it. But that should not surprise us. The world has a long history of closing its eyes to domestic violence.
If you look at the film industry, you cannot deny the crucial role it plays in education. We simply do what we see in the movies. The wrong behavior seems to have been portrayed since the beginning though: silent films have been hiding scenes of abuse towards women under the mask of entertainment for almost 100 years.
ANAIS, a local organization that supports domestic violence victims wanted to undo the wrong. With the loss of copyright of dozens of these silent movies on January 1st 2019, Anais wandered if they could be turned into an empowering cinematographic product for the next generation?
This was the birth of “Unquiet Voices”, a 40-minute movie that breaks a 100-year-old silence. 7 victims of domestic violence broke the silence and give voice, for the first time, to abused characters in silent movies. They hope to inspire other women to find the strength to do the same and share their own story of abuse.
